DECOMPOSABLE SEC-DED CODES OF ENHANCED AUGMENTED PRODUCT CODE CONSTRUCTION

Abstract (2. Language): 
Enhanced augmented product code construction (EAPCC) and its decomposable SEC-DED (single-error-correcting/double-error-detecting) codes, which are composed by augmenting the simple component codes (2,1,2) and (2,1,1) on to a two dimensional general product code structure, are presented by this paper. Some of the best-known codes with minimum distance four that have been attained using this method have also been presented as a result of simulations.
